Product description

One beautiful transparent 1.05 carat round shape greenish blue sapphire, measuring 6.19 by 6.19 by 3.31 millimeters, presents a rare combination of depth and liveliness that you will not often find in stones of this size. Cut in a faceted mixed brilliant style, this gem balances the flash of a brilliant crown with the depth and color saturation emphasized by a pavilion cut. The clarity is graded very slightly included at eye level, which means the gem is essentially eye clean to most observers while retaining natural character visible only under magnification. With a dark color intensity and an excellent polish, this sapphire retains a luxurious presence whether mounted in a simple solitaire or a more elaborate setting. Heat treated for optimum color stability, and originating from Australia, this stone carries a distinct greenish blue personality that sets it apart from more common blue and cornflower tones, and it is offered to you by The Natural Sapphire Company with our commitment to transparent sourcing and meticulous craftsmanship.

When you compare this Australian greenish blue sapphire to other sapphires commonly available on the market, several advantages become clear. Many commercial stones emphasize size over quality, or they present lighter blues that lack the dramatic depth of color found in this piece. Compared to Sri Lankan stones that tend toward lighter and brighter cornflower blues, and compared to Burmese stones which can push toward royal blue, this Australian gem occupies a unique niche with its teal leaning tones and dark richness. The mixed brilliant cut distinguishes it from standard full brilliant or step cuts by delivering both scintillation and color concentration, producing a livelier face up appearance than poorly cut stones of similar weight. The very slightly included clarity offers the practical benefit of a more affordable price than flawless or loupe clean stones, while still maintaining the visual purity that most buyers seek, making this sapphire a superior value proposition for those who want a striking natural gem without the premium paid for absolute perfection.

The way this sapphire will shine under different lighting conditions is one of its most compelling features. In bright natural daylight, especially indirect northern light, the gem opens up to reveal lively teal flashes across its surface, with the mixed brilliant facets throwing bright pinpoints of white sparkle. Under strong southern sunlight the darker overall tone becomes more apparent, and the stone shows deep oceanic blue centers framed by lighter outer facets, creating a sense of depth and three dimensionality. Under cool LED or fluorescent lighting, the polished facets emphasize brilliance and scintillation, making the gem appear livelier and cooler in tone, while under warm incandescent light or candlelight the greenish blue warmth is accentuated, yielding a softer, more romantic glow with hints of deep teal and forest blue. When viewed at different angles the mixed cutting style encourages a play between bright flashes and saturated color, allowing the stone to read as dark and mysterious in some moments, and as vibrant and jewel like in others.

From a practical perspective this sapphire is built to outperform many alternatives in everyday wear. Sapphires are second only to diamonds in hardness among commonly used gemstones, and this Australian example benefits from an excellent polish that maximizes surface resilience and reduces the visibility of minor contact marks. The heat treatment applied is a well established and widely accepted enhancement that enhances color stability without compromising structural integrity, and it is disclosed so that you can make an informed purchase. Compared to lower quality stones with heavier surface abrasions, poor facet symmetry, or obvious inclusions, this gem delivers superior optical performance and a cleaner face up presentation. The dark color intensity masks tiny inclusions, making the very slightly included clarity grade an advantage, because buyers receive a stone that appears visually pristine at a more approachable price point when compared to higher clarity, lighter colored sapphires that command a premium.

For maximum brilliance consider a setting that allows light to enter the pavilion, such as a four or six prong solitaire, or pair it with a halo of small white stones to accentuate the bright facet flashes while preserving the gem s depth. For a more vintage or understated look a bezel may deepen the color and protect the girdle without sacrificing the gem s character.
